Full Description

North America In-Building Networks Sales Manager – South Central Territory • * Must be U.S. Citizen or Green Card Holder living in the South Central region Scope of Position: As a Sales Manager for the South-Central Territory, you are responsible for creating and cultivating long-term relationships that drive in-building wireless business through network operators, Value Added Resellers (VAR’s) and other assigned accounts. Your extensive network of relationships with these customers will enable you to grow established accounts and introduce new prospects to Airspan. Your work will focus on driving preference for our Airspan product offering with regional businesses and technology organizations. Internally, you will align your customers with Airspan marketing, engineering services, sales and support organizations to drive and convert a pipeline of new business. Externally, you will leverage existing relationships and grow new ones to drive Airspan’s Wireless solutions in the market. You will be required to have both sales and technical expertise in cellular networks and related technologies. Responsibilities: • Lead Airspan’s relationships with assigned network operators, value added resellers and strategic partners to create and win opportunities for in-building wireless solutions. • Cultivate relationships between your customers and Airspan’s key commercial partners: consultants, distributors, re-sellers and systems integrators to drive preference and new business for Airspan’s in-building wireless solutions. • Align your customers with Airspan’s enterprise and carrier sales teams to maximize cross-selling and to identify and close opportunities and maximize team collaboration. • Achieve your assigned revenue and bookings quota. • Partner with internal stakeholders to ensure that all pre and post sales customer needs are met. • Leverage industry trade groups and organizations to support and drive business to your customers. • Represent Airspan at conferences and seminars. • Leverage Airspan resources to ensure that your customers: -Are trained on Airspan solutions -Articulate Airspan’s competitive advantage in the marketplace -Communicate Airspan’s value through case studies, promotions and social media • Generate an annual sales plan with metrics and provide quarterly progress to the VP of Sales • Collaborate with marketing to develop and deploy campaigns and incentive offerings. • Collaborate with wireless and enterprise sales teams to use Salesforce.com to document all sales activities, contacts, and opportunity forecasts - update in real time. You will carry a quota, as well as team level and company level objectives. Travel: Domestic travel of approximately 50% (TX, LA, AR, OK) Hours: Full-time, 40 hours/week+ Experience and Desired Skill Sets: • 10 years demonstrated key account management experience creating and cultivating long-term, multi-product relationships with wireless network operators. • Demonstrated relationships with key strategic 3PO’s and Tier 1 Wireless Service Providers. • 10-15 years demonstrated experience in direct sales with successful track record of exceeding quota. • Track record of new business development and successful execution of complex, multi-faceted partner/reseller agreements. • Extensive cellular industry product and application knowledge, specifically in DAS, RAN and RAN Software. • Desired subject matter expertise selling some or all of the following: -Wireless Distributed Antenna Systems (DAS) - Wireless Radio Access Network (RAN) Solutions and Equipment -Network Infrastructure -Private Wireless Networks -Wireless Network Software and Services -Network Convergence -Wi-Fi and/or Wireless LAN Education: • Bachelor’s degree required -- prefer business, engineering, or related industry This position does not support immigration sponsorship.
